What is sperm motility?

Jun 4, 2021

Sperm motility is the movement of sperm and its ability to move efficiently through the female reproductive tract to reach the egg. Sperm motility is a factor in successful conception; if sperm do not move well, they will not reach the egg to fertilize it.

Poor sperm motility means that the sperm do not swim properly which can lead to male infertility. Usually, it is found that when sperm motility is poor, there are other contributing problems found with sperm health such as sperm morphology or low sperm count.
